Beijing stands at the forefront of China’s digital transformation, hosting more than 200 AI research labs and over 30 fintech incubators in its tech districts. The city’s high‑speed 5G network and government‑backed innovation zones give developers instant access to cutting‑edge hardware and data pipelines, making it an ideal launchpad for startups and scale‑ups alike.

Key players such as ByteDance, DJI, Tencent, Huawei, and Alibaba’s cloud arm anchor the ecosystem, while emerging firms in smart manufacturing, biotech, and e‑commerce—like Meituan and Pinduoduo—offer diverse career paths. Software engineers, data scientists, AI researchers, product managers, and cybersecurity specialists find roles across these sectors.

Living costs in Beijing’s central districts—Chaoyang, Dongcheng, and Xicheng—can push monthly rent to ¥12,000‑¥18,000 for a one‑bedroom apartment. Given this expense, salary transparency lets candidates benchmark against industry standards, negotiate benefits, and ensure their compensation keeps pace with local living costs.

Frequently Asked Questions

What types of tech jobs are available in Beijing?
Beijing offers software engineering, data science, AI research, product management, UI/UX design, cybersecurity, cloud operations, and blockchain development roles. Startups and large firms alike need engineers skilled in Python, Java, Go, and AI frameworks such as TensorFlow and PyTorch.
Is remote work common for tech roles in Beijing?
Hybrid models dominate in major firms like ByteDance and Tencent, allowing two or three remote days per week. Purely remote roles are rare; most positions require on‑site presence in Chaoyang or Haidian to facilitate collaboration and access to high‑performance GPUs.
Who are the major employers in Beijing's tech scene?
Key employers include ByteDance, DJI, Tencent, Huawei, Alibaba Cloud, Meituan, Pinduoduo, and the Institute of Automation, Chinese Academy of Sciences. These companies span AI, e‑commerce, cloud, smart manufacturing, and fintech.
What are the salary expectations for tech roles in Beijing?
Monthly salaries for mid‑level software engineers range from ¥20,000 to ¥35,000; senior engineers command ¥35,000 to ¥50,000. AI researchers earn ¥30,000‑¥45,000, while product managers earn ¥25,000‑¥40,000. Salary transparency helps compare offers and negotiate bonuses or equity.
What advice should I consider when relocating to Beijing for tech work?
Research neighborhoods: Chaoyang offers proximity to tech parks; Haidian is tech‑hub and affordable. Secure a work visa before arrival, budget ¥12,000‑¥18,000 for rent, and use public transport passes to reduce commuting costs. Join local meetups and LinkedIn groups to build a network and learn about housing subsidies for expats.
